A SaaS contract is an agreement between a software supplier and a customer outlining the conditions of use for a cloud-based application.
You need a consolidated platform that streamlines contract negotiation, keeps track of approval workflows and stays on top of renewal dates. In this article, we will learn how SaaS contract management systems can provide complete visibility in one tab.
A SaaS contract is the foundation of the relationship between an organization and the SaaS vendor. It is the legally binding agreement that defines how organizations use and pay for their SaaS. It typically includes:
While every SaaS vendor will have a template contract, most of them allow great flexibility in the terms and conditions. This is the leverage organizations have to get a contract that serves them well.
A robust SaaS contract protects both you and your software vendor. It crystallizes the terms you’ve agreed on and helps resolving disputes, if any arise. In case of a data breach, it limits the company’s liability and safeguards against revenue loss and customer loss. It strengthens your relationship with the software vendor ensuring the following.
Transparency: By clearly outlining the terms of software access and services provided, it can help prevent unexpected costs and save money in the long run. This is particularly important when adding new services to the SaaS stack.
Security: It considers all reasonable eventualities and sets guardrails for them. In case of a security attack, data breach, unauthorized access etc., it protects you and the software vendor.
Flexibility: Your needs from the SaaS product you are buying might change depending on your growth, strategy and even economic conditions. A good SaaS contract empowers you to be flexible in such cases.
Intellectual property delineation: Most organizations use SaaS tools to build their own products. A strong intellectual property clause assigns the ownership and usage rights of both parties.
Reliable customer-vendor relationship: A SaaS contract enhances the customer–vendor relationship by defining responsibilities, setting clear expectations, delivering flexibility, ensuring data privacy and providing a framework for dispute resolution. Further, it establishes trust, accountability and transparency between both parties.
Given how important it is to start a relationship with your SaaS vendor on the right foot, SaaS contracts need to be managed effectively. Here’s how.
SaaS contracts are special and different from regular contracts in several ways.
Managing SaaS contract can be difficult due to several reasons:
SaaS contract management is a method used to create, negotiate, sign, store and execute contracts for SaaS services. It unifies all your contracts in one place.
Typically, organizations do this across multiple disparate tools such as emails, spreadsheets and Google Drive/Dropbox. This creates specific problems:
To prevent this and bring efficiency into the SaaS contract management process, a unified platform is essential.
SaaS contract management tools have changed the way businesses handle contracts. From procurement to renewal, these tools ensure efficient and streamlined contract management processes. The process will enable you to:
While a SaaS contract is typically drafted by the vendor, you can ask for terms and clauses to be included to protect you. This helps ensure consistency and accuracy, while minimizing errors.
A SaaS contract might need to go through procurement, IT, legal, finance and sometimes, even the CEO’s office, in addition to vendor teams. To prevent important aspects falling through the cracks, a good contract management solution can enable simultaneous collaboration, similar to platforms like Teams, Google Docs and Slack. People can work on documents together, track changes and use approval workflows to confirm proper review and sign-off.
You can easily monitor spend analytics, SaaS contract negotiation timelines, user interactions, clause modifications, enforcement dates and more. This data-driven approach allows you to make informed decisions, mitigate risk and monitor real-time performance.
SaaS contract management software provides you with a holistic view of contracts, guaranteeing seamless management throughout their lifecycle. Renewal alerts and notifications keep stakeholders informed, while the system lets you make easy contract amendments and additions when needed.
Contract management solutions benefit sales, HR, legal, procurement, finance, IT, compliance, marketing and operations teams in the following ways:
IT teams can monitor the status of software licenses and ensure that SLAs are being met. This prevents any issues with software access or performance and ensures that the organization is getting the most value from its SaaS subscriptions.
Compliance teams can track the status of regulatory and contractual obligations, preventing any issues with regulatory compliance. With clear visibility, they can also ensure that compliance is up-to-date, even as the regulations evolve.
HR and operations teams can track who owns and uses existing SaaS licenses to always stay on top of employee costs. They can also optimize SaaS spends by regularly evaluating user sentiment and rightsizing SaaS contracts.
Finance teams can have granular visibility into their SaaS spends. This is especially useful for usage-based pricing tools where the expenses can often be unpredictable.
The CEO's office can stay on top of the third-biggest expense on their P&L. They can conduct reviews based on real-time data and ROI projections.
From improving efficiency to effective dispute resolution, SaaS contract management can reduce cycle times, reduce administrative maintenance and do multiple tasks. Here are the key benefits of a SaaS contract management software:
Implementing a contract management system enables streamlined contract information retrieval, renegotiation and renewal processes, saving time in reducing operational expenses. In addition, the comprehensive visualization and financial analysis capabilities help you understand the financial impact of SaaS renewals, enabling planning, monitoring and decision-making.
Leveraging the insights and analytics that the tool has to offer, you can identify inefficiencies in your SaaS portfolio and optimize contracts based on actual usage and unnecessary expenditures. Also, you can easily scale up or down subscriptions and licenses to align with your evolving business needs, ensuring optimal resource allocation.
The collaborative approach to contract facilitates standardization of the renewal process, establishing clear roles and responsibilities and ensuring consistent and efficient operations. So when you centralize a contract management system, ensure that your SaaS solution aligns with the contract terms, company policies and industry standards, reducing compliance risks.
SaaS contract management helps simplify operations, reduce risks, and maximize benefits and value for both the companies offering SaaS and their customers. Even though managing these contracts can seem tricky, these best practices can help you handle these challenges.
With 250+ tools used by various teams in the organization, a consolidated view of all contracts is essential. You can do this by organizing crucial information in a spreadsheet, including current spending, stakeholders, contract renewal dates and sales representative details. However, the manual effort involved in creating and updating this spreadsheet might be significant. A better approach is to use a tool like Spendflo to unify SaaS contracts.
Auto-renewal clauses are common in SaaS contracts, but they can lead to unexpected costs and unused subscriptions. While buying any SaaS tool, ensure you’re not signing up for auto-renewals. For your existing contracts, conduct regular audits and proactively turn off auto-renewals. Reach out to your sales representatives or account managers to request alternative renewal terms that align with your needs.
Never wait for SaaS providers to notify you about your contract expiry. Be proactive and stay ahead of the game. Aim to be at least 90 days ahead of the contract renewal deadline. This gives you ample time to evaluate costs, explore alternatives and negotiate new terms if required.
Avoid the hassle and potential risks associated with several stakeholders using company credit cards for SaaS purchases. Instead, ask SaaS vendors to raise invoices and issue a purchase order for them. Pay them based on these purchase orders.
When negotiating SaaS agreements, partner with companies that accommodate your growth and do not penalize you for exceeding usage limits during the contract period. Clarify these terms upfront to avoid surprises down the line.
SaaS vendors are more likely to offer bigger discounts when you opt for longer-term contracts. Use this to your advantage. If multi-year commitments are not feasible, negotiate cap rates to limit price increases within a certain range for upcoming renewals.
Seek suppliers who understand and accommodate your scalability needs. Additionally, explore economies of scale for both major and minor software contracts to optimize spending and avoid overspending on unnecessary tools.
Proactively track SaaS usage among your teams. Make renewal decisions based on how your teams are using and liking their SaaS tools. You can also use this data to inform your new procurement as well.
Investing in building strong relationships with your SaaS suppliers reaps long-term benefits and potential cost savings. You can leverage your company’s reputation, customer testimonials or co-marketing opportunities to negotiate more feasible rates.
While contract negotiation is a multi-faceted process, here are the SaaS contract negotiation checklist questions that you must ask:
SaaS contract management can improve contract lifecycle efficiency and save costs for companies. Put the “control” back in contracts with the Spendflo contract management suite.
Book your free demo today and save up to 30% on your SaaS spends.
A SaaS agreement is a contract between a provider and a customer specifically for accessing and using cloud-based software. It outlines terms regarding usage rights, subscription fees, service levels, and data protection. An MSA (master service agreement), on the other hand, is a comprehensive contract that establishes the general terms and conditions of a business relationship, covering aspects like performance standards, payment terms, intellectual property rights, and liability issues. While a SaaS agreement focuses on software services, an MSA covers broader aspects of the partnership between service providers and clients.
A cloud-based contract management system is software hosted on the Internet, allowing businesses to create, store, manage, and track contracts digitally. This system provides secure access to contract data from anywhere, at any time, facilitating better collaboration, reducing the risk of lost or mismanaged documents, and streamlining the entire contract lifecycle from drafting through execution to renewal or termination. It often includes automated reminders, electronic signatures, and analytics for better contract oversight.
Yes, a contract is essential for SaaS offerings. This contract, often called a SaaS agreement, outlines the terms and conditions under which customers can use the software, including subscription fees, service level agreements (SLAs), data handling policies, and user rights. It protects both the service provider and the customer by clearly defining expectations, responsibilities, and recourse in the event of service issues or disputes.
CRM and contract management serve different purposes in a business setting. CRM systems help companies handle their dealings with both existing and potential clients. By analyzing data, they improve sales activities, offer customer support, and nurture relationships. However, Contract management manages legal agreements between parties, such as customers, partners, or suppliers. It involves the creation, execution, and analysis of contracts to ensure compliance, performance, and efficiency in business operations.
Contract management software offers several advantages, including improved efficiency, reduced risk, and compliance. It automates many aspects of the contract lifecycle, from drafting and signing to renewal, making processes faster and reducing the likelihood of errors. This software ensures all contracts are stored securely in one place, making them easily accessible and trackable. Additionally, it helps businesses stay compliant with regulations and contractual obligations by providing tools for monitoring contract terms and deadlines.